POSITION OBJECTIVE: The Project Manager (PM) is a key player on our construction team, and has overall responsibility for project success including profitability, safety, quality, schedule, and customer satisfaction. FCL Project Managers are passionate problem solvers who serve as trusted advisors and lead our project teams to exceed customer expectations. PMs own their projects, coordinating and leading their respective project teams (Superintendents, Assistant Project Managers/Engineers, Project Administrators, Project Accountants) in a professional manner that contributes to the overall success of FCL. The PM has the experience to execute projects from start to finish; the ability to cultivate and maintain strong relationships resulting in customer satisfaction; and the commitment to create and maintain a safety culture. Project Managers clearly communicate with Superintendents, subcontractors, and owners; have a strong understanding of budgets, cost control and accounting; are results oriented with proven ability to organize, plan and prioritize work to meet deadlines; and are known for being able to provide innovative and sound solutions to complex problems.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

PRE-CONSTRUCTION, PROJECT AND SCHEDULE MANAGEMENT
  • Responsible for ensuring overall success of projects directly responsible to manage
  • Read the complete Owners Contract and understand and implement the requirements of this agreement
  • Review and develop written project scope and develop project budgets
  • Responsible for managing the change order process on their project
  • Conduct regular reviews of schematic design drawings, design development drawings and construction documents and design milestones throughout the design process to ensure project design coincides with project outline specifications, project schedule and budget
  • Participate in planning meetings with design professionals
  • Gather information, write and submit all RFI's (Request for Information) to Architect, Engineer or Owner and distribute responses to all bidding subcontractors, and/or work with and train a APM or PE in doing task such as RFIs
  • Work with Regional Vice Presidents to write Owner contracts based on final construction documents, approved Owner proposal and approved schedule
  • Keep the office leadership informed regarding subcontractor buyout and contract award process
  • Develop timelines and critical path schedule, including phasing to facilitate ongoing project activities
  • Coordinate subcontracts to be written based on approved scope
  • Coordinate with Project Administrator (PA) to send out approved contracts with schedule and pertinent project information to all subcontractors to be working on the project
  • Coordinate development of a Superintendent Project Package which includes a copy of project permit including all required inspections, schedule, subcontractor list and all contract scopes for use by Superintendent in the field
  • Coordinate pre-construction planning with design team, owners, subcontractors prior to the commencement of each project
  • Coordinate punch list development with Architect, Owner and distribute to all team members
  • Facilitate building start-up and commissioning for required items between FCL, subcontractors and owner


RELATIONSHIP MANAGEMENT
  • Act as the lead construction representative on each project working with design team, owners, subcontracts and FCL team
  • Interface daily with FCL Superintendent to check on project progress and discuss any questions/issues/concerns in the field
  • Oversee weekly on-site construction meetings and document progress by issuing weekly meeting minutes and a revised/updated project schedule via email within 24 hours of site meeting to all subs, architect and FCL Team Members
  • Build a relationship with the Owner's Representative for all projects you are working on. Be their "Go to" within FCL.
  • Develop, strengthen and maintain client and subcontractor relationships.
  • Create and foster collaborative and effective relationships with all team members by acting with the highest level of ethics and integrity.
  • Coach, mentor, teach and develop Project Engineers and Assistant Project Managers toward becoming a Project Manager


FINANCIAL MANAGEMENT
  • Review and Approve payment applications and change order requests with accounting and coordinate payment applications to be completed and sent to Owner according to timelines in Owner contract
  • Oversee completion and collection of close-out documents, and processing of final payments
  • Oversee, manage and update the Project Budget to provide accurate Monthly Cost to Completes


CHANGE ORDER MANAGEMENT
  • Evaluate Subcontractor Change Orders (SCOs) and be responsible for the process to write SCO's and distribute SCO's to the subcontractor
  • Develop Owner Change Orders (OCOs) description and be responsible for the process in writing OCO's, distribute OCO's to Owner and obtain written approval

KEY SUCCESS FACTORS

Following are key success factors for this role which measure results in meeting critical elements of the position. The specific goals for each element are set annually.

PROJECT SUCCESS

Measured by overall project profitability, including maintaining original profit in proposal, buy out and management of change orders.

RELATIONSHIP MANAGEMENT

Measured by customer satisfaction rating at project completion.

SCHEDULE MANAGEMENT

Defined as adherence or improvement to initial schedule, maintenance of change orders and timely execution of project close out and punch list.
